The usage of a bow shackle is an usual practice in rigging and lifting applications. Bow shackles are especially preferred due to their stamina and convenience. With their rounded shape and broad throat, they are created to suit a selection of lifting chains, ropes, and slings, making them suitable for both sturdy and lighter applications. Whether you're in building, towing, or any kind of heavy lifting, recognizing exactly how to effectively make use of and safeguard a bow shackle is crucial to make certain a secure and reliable lifting procedure.Complementing the bow shackle are heavy-duty shackles, which are constructed to withstand extreme lots and rough environmental conditions. These shackles typically have a larger pin and a sturdier body design, making certain that they can manage the stress and anxiety of significant weights. They offer an important function in various industries, consisting of maritime, building and construction, and logistics, where trustworthy and long lasting connections are paramount. Heavy-duty shackles permit lift strategies to suit big loads without the risk of failing, making them a crucial part in any type of lifting configuration. Proper selection, examination, and upkeep of these shackles are important for safe operations, as also tiny flaws can result in significant hazards.
In addition to shackles, snap hooks are versatile devices used for a myriad of applications, consisting of climbing, fishing, and construction. Their straightforward style-- characterized by a spring-loaded gateway-- enables quick add-ons and detachments, which can be extremely valuable in vibrant work settings. Snap hooks been available in various dimensions and products, guaranteeing that there's an option for virtually every application. While they're typically seen as tiny and simple tools, they must still be made use of with care. Comprehending the weight limitations and appropriate usage standards is essential for maximizing their efficiency and keeping security standards.
When securing tons, especially in maritime operations or towing, anchor chains play a crucial function. These chains are especially created for holding fast in deep waters, supplying a secure and risk-free anchor factor for boats and ships. Anchor chains should be durable and immune to corrosion, as they are subjected to the components and underwater pressures. Their web links are frequently broader and larger compared to common chains, and they can work in conjunction with numerous shackles to create a safe and secure hold. Selecting the proper anchor chain based upon the size of the vessel and expected ecological problems is essential to prevent accidents and guarantee trustworthy performance.
Lifting hooks are an additional fundamental element of lifting and rigging systems, offering an accessory point for slings, cords, or various other lifting gadgets. These hooks come in numerous layouts, consisting of swivel hooks, which permit for turning to prevent twisting, and latch hooks, which offer additional safety and security to avoid unintentional disengagement throughout lifting.

In combination with wire ropes, lifting webbing has become a preferred choice for securing and lifting loads. Made from artificial fibers, lifting webbing is lightweight, flexible, and extremely solid. This kind of rigging provides a low-impact lifting remedy that minimizes the risk of damages to lots, particularly in applications like moving breakable products. The flexibility of lifting webbing allows for a selection of setups, making it suitable for several markets, including industrial production and logistics. It is crucial, however, to make certain that these bands are rated suitably for the tons they are lifting to stop failings that might endanger both the lots and people in the vicinity.
The aluminum carabiner clip is an ever-present function in both climbing and commercial applications, owing to its light-weight nature and ease of usage. These clips are developed to take care of dynamic lots, and their quick-locking systems provide additional security when connecting to harnesses, ropes, or other tools. The importance of making use of the best type of carabiner can not be overemphasized-- climbers, as an example, often depend on auto-locking and locking systems to ensure their security. In industrial settings, picking the appropriate aluminum carabiner can boost process and make certain that security laws are satisfied without endangering efficiency.
